Join Allied Universal as an unarmed patrol officer supporting a busy public transportation location. Conduct routine patrols, maintain a visible presence to help deter security-related incidents, observe and report concerns, and provide courteous assistance to passengers, employees, and visitors.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to passengers, visitors, and transit personnel by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and emergency response activities when appropriate.
  • Conduct regular and random unarmed patrols of transit stations, platforms, parking areas, facilities, and surrounding perimeters to help identify suspicious activity, hazards, and policy violations.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, professional, and problem-solving manner, contacting emergency services and/or designated personnel as needed.
  • Monitor public areas and access points, help to deter unauthorized activity, and provide directions or assistance to members of the public.
  • Document patrol activity, observations, incidents, and security-related concerns through clear and timely reports.
